What is difference between riyal and baisa?

In fact, the baisa is the subunit of the Omani Rial: 1 rial equals 1000 baisa. This may confuse people who are used to the European and American currencies, where the main unit is divided into 100 subunits.

Can I use UAE dirham in Oman?

Shops in Oman will not accept Dollars or Euros, even the touristy ones. The only currency that is occasionally accepted is the Emarati Dirham (AED). ATM machines are found almost everywhere around the capital, and are commonly found at petrol stations and major shopping areas in other cities around the country.

    What is the currency history in Oman?

    Zanzibar collection.

  • Indian Rupee – issued by the Government of India (British) 1927-1948
  • Indian Rupee – issued by the Reserve bank of India 1949
  • Gulf Rupee – issued by the Government of India 1957
  • Saidi Rial – issued by the Muscat Monetary Authority 1970
  • Oman Rial – issued by the Omani Monetary Council 1972
